DONALD STRATYCHUK
Peacefully after a brief illness it is with deep sorrow and regret that we announce the death of Donald Stratychuk on Friday, October 16, 2015 at the Grace Hospital in Winnipeg, Manitoba, at the age of 86 years.
Remaining to mourn Donald’s memory are his son Perry; numerous nieces; nephews; and friends. He was predeceased by his beloved wife of 53 years, Catherine, in 2011.
Donald loved his family dearly and took pride in a home he and Cathy renovated and landscaped into a cottage in the city. He excelled in carpentry, photography and other interests including his favourite sport of golf, for which he won a championship in the 1960’s and played into his 80’s. Born on February 2, 1929 near Canora, Saskatchewan, Donald worked on farms before moving to St. Boniface, Manitoba and later, Ontario to work for Ontario Hydro and Minaki Lodge. With his wife and son, Donald returned to Manitoba where his career of 35 years with the City of Winnipeg included carpenter, park police officer, golf course superintendent and manager of city golf course maintenance until his retirement. A lover of nature and wildlife, Donald was also an avid reader of frontier and western novels, acquiring a collection of related books and movies. He also enjoyed auto shows, Star Trek and curling tournaments. With a keen interest in baseball, he followed the Toronto Blue Jays and attended an occasional Winnipeg Goldeyes game.
